My System: Sky + HD | ESPN America UK is a completely different feed to European feed. The European feed has full rights to the NFL which i'm interested in. I have relatives in France so subscription through their address might be possible. Also a German provider has it as part of their FTA coverage i beleive. There must be a way to pick up a feed from Europe somewhere...well i hope so lol | ||

I've been looking into this as well and what I gathered is that the cheapest way to get it (unless you friends in Europe) is to buy the TV Vlaanderen Plus package for a year. I think the cheapest broker price I've found is about £350. Hope this helps. | |||
